Latest Answer: The current FSI stands at 1.5 in Chennai for ordinary building (Not more that 8 units or high-rise building).
Plot Coverage - At the ground floor, the constructed area coverage shall not exceed 70% of the Land area. This means the entire construction, though within the norms should not be done to cover the entire plot. This ensures opens space which is essential for air, natural light and safe in times of emergencies.
Setback Space - Front, side and rear setback shall not be allowed as per the Regulation. The details may vary depends on the dimension of the plot.
Height of the building - It should not be exceed 1.5 times the width of the road or maximum of 9 meters.

Q:The market is running with a belief that FSI will go up, and that the option to buy additional TDR is beneficial for Mumbai real estate companies. Is that belief correct?
Latest Answer: Yes, earlier, TDR was available like any other commodity. It could be used anywhere in any part of Mumbai. The price was neutral. Demand and supply were the guiding factors. But today, it is very clearly differentiated based on RR rates.

Q:The Maharashtra Govt. will soon come up with a new policy that will make it compulsory for private builders to transfer a certain housing stock to Maharashtra Housing and Area Development Authority.
Latest Answer: It is because, MHADA and some other govt. agencies have a limit on construction of houses as it becomes financially not useful for them who are beyond a certain limit. Thereby, the govt. wants the participation of private builders to ensure affordable homes to a large number of people.
